Shipley joins ICA staff

Iowa

The Iowa Cattlemen's Association is pleased to announce Tom Shipley as Director of Issues Management and Policy Implementation. The newly-developed position is designed to work with producers in further identifying issues impacting Iowa Cattlemen's Association members, and to oversee ICA policy implementation in the Iowa Legislature and with regulatory agencies.

Shipley has a bachelor of science degree in ag education from Iowa State University. He is a native of Southwest Iowa and has been actively involved in both the Adams and Mills-Montgomery county cattlemen's associations. Shipley previously served as District 18 Director and cow-calf representative on the Iowa Cattlemen's Association board as well as co-chairing the membership committee.

"Over the years I have dedicated a great deal of time to the Iowa Cattlemen's Association because I have seen the value of the organization. I now look forward to serving the Association and our members on a fulltime basis", says Shipley.

Shipley will assume his new duties at the ICA headquarters in Ames Oct. 20.
